How Workouts Enhance Sleep
Physical Fatigue Benefits
Deepening Sleep Cycles
Moderate exercise increases slow-wave sleep, the restorative phase, per research findings.
Try Brisk Walking
30 minutes daily can tire your body just enough for better rest.
Avoid Overdoing It
Excessive strain may overstimulate—keep it balanced.
Stress Relief Through Movement
Easing Tension
Workouts burn off stress hormones, helping you relax into sleep more easily.
Opt for Tai Chi
This gentle practice calms both mind and body for bedtime.
Schedule Early
Morning or afternoon sessions maximize stress reduction benefits.
Best Workouts for Restful Nights
Low-Impact Options
Swimming for Calm
Water’s resistance tires muscles without spiking adrenaline—ideal for sleep prep.
Keep It Short
20-30 minutes is enough to signal rest without exhaustion.
Cool Off After
A post-swim stretch helps transition to relaxation mode.
Strength and Flexibility
Lift Light Weights
Moderate resistance training boosts sleep duration without overactivation.
Focus on Form
Slow, controlled reps enhance benefits and safety.
